To reproduce this issue, the following can be done:

1. Create a jammy autopkgtest image via: autopkgtest-buildvm-cloud-ubuntu -r 
jammy
2. Install the 5.15.0-27-29+rfkill2 headers, modules, and unsigned image from 
https://launchpad.net/~ztahenakos/+archive/ubuntu/zt-test-kernels/+build/23733020
 into the image.
3. Run the network-manager autopkgtest

The kernel in step 2 is Jammy linux 5.15.0-27.28 with upstream
54f586a9153201 (rfkill: make new event layout opt-in) added on top.
Based on comments in include/uapi/linux/rfkill.h, userspace changes may
be necessary in order for correct communication with rfkill to work,
otherwise we may start to see more failures in rfkill based tests or
usage.
